Abstract
A fluid pumping device for use in the petroleum and/or chemical industries includes a cast fluid housing having an inlet to or an outlet from the fluid pumping device, a drain/vent tubular connection extending through the cast fluid housing to communicate with the inlet to or the outlet of the fluid pumping device and a flange adapter sealingly secured to the cast fluid housing. A method of providing a drain/vent tube to structurally communicate with an inlet to or the outlet from a fluid pumping device is disclosed.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A fluid pumping device for use in the petroleum and/or chemical industries, comprising:
(a) a cast fluid housing member having an inlet to or an outlet from the fluid pumping device and having a sidewall thereon; (b) a drain/vent tubular connection positioned in said cast fluid housing to engage and communicate with said inlet to or said outlet from the fluid pumping device, with said drain/vent tubular connection exiting as said sidewall; and (c) a flange adapter member secured to said cast fluid housing and structurally arranged to communicate with said drain/vent tubular connection.
2 . The fluid pumping device in accordance with claim 1 wherein said drain/vent tubular connection is positioned in said fluid housing to communicate with said inlet to or outlet from said pumping device by drilling said drain/vent connection in said fluid housing.
3 . The fluid pumping device in accordance with claim 1 wherein said sidewall of said cast fluid housing is positioned substantially perpendicular to said exit of said drain/vent tubular connection from said fluid housing.
4 . The fluid pumping device in accordance with claim 3 , wherein said sidewall of said fluid housing includes an annular recess extending around the exit of said drain/vent tubular connection.
5 . The fluid pumping device in accordance with claim 1 , wherein said flange adapter member includes an axial bore extending therethrough and a male projection portion structurally arranged to engage said cast fluid housing to communicate with said drain/vent tubular connection.
6 . The fluid pumping device in accordance with claim 4 , wherein said flange adapter member includes a axial bore therethrough and a male projection portion structurally arranged to engage said annular recess in said sidewall of said fluid housing.
7 . The fluid pumping device in accordance with claim 5 , wherein said male projection portion includes at least one annular groove extending therearound.
8 . The fluid pumping device in accordance with claim 5 , wherein each of said at least one annular groove in said male projection portion includes an—o-ring member to seal said flange adapter member to said fluid housing.
9 . A method of providing a drain/vent tube to structurally communicate with the inlet or outlet of a cast fluid pumping device, comprising the steps of:
(a) drilling a drain/vent tubular connection in the cast fluid pumping device to engage and communicate with the inlet or outlet therein; and (b) mounting a flange adapter member to the cast fluid pumping device to communicate with said drain/vent tubular connection to permit release of fluid from the pumping device.Cited by (0)
